Output 3d12a5c30897612330d42aef2451430fa608bad25b916914e425f9a9c71ad435:0

value
10153
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3bc745219fe6d86f3e5ae20bbbc90670d3fa6a81f771e39dac434e4ee33c346a
address
ltc1p80r52gvlumvx70j6ug9mhjgxwrfl565p7ac788dvgd8yaceux34qpwf79x
transaction
3d12a5c30897612330d42aef2451430fa608bad25b916914e425f9a9c71ad435
spent
true